TIGERS (career vs. Carrasco).
Ian Kinsler, 2B (7-for-30, 3 doubles, walk, 6 K’s)
Cameron Maybin, CF (1-for-4, double, K)
Miguel Cabrera, 1B (10-for-28, double, HR, 3 walks, 7 K’s)
Victor Martinez, DH (6-for-26, 2 doubles, walk, 2 K’s)
Justin Upton, LF (1-for-6, HR, 2 K’s)
Steven Moya, RF
Mike Aviles, 3B
James McCann, C (0-for-8, 4 K’s)
Jose Iglesias, SS (4-for-11, double, walk, 3 K’s)
P: Anibal Sanchez

INDIANS (career numbers off Sanchez).
Carlos Santana, DH (7-for-25, double, triple, HR, 5 walks, 6 K’s)
Jason Kipnis, 2B (5-for-30, double, walk, 9 K’s)
Francisco Lindor, SS (2-for-6, double, walk)
Mike Napoli, 1B (6-for-15, 2 doubles, 2 HR, 4 walks, 5 K’s)
Jose Ramirez, 3B (1-for-4)
Lonnie Chisenhall, RF (6-for-22, triple, walk, 4 K’s)
Rajai Davis, LF (4-for-15, 2 doubles, walk, 5 K’s)
Tyler Naquin, CF (1-for-6, double, 3 K’s)
Yan Gomes, C (7-for-16, double, triple, 2 HR, walk, 3 K’s)
P: Carlos Carrasco
